By default, the RRATalog parser assumed that all values were measured at 1.4GHz, which isn't always the case. This changes the
update_rrats.cshscript to a bash script,update_rrats.shwhich correctly accounts for this, parses the current three frequency samples, and sorts them by name in the outputrrats_noheadfile.This also updates the output
rrats_noheadfile (some values may change due to updates/rounding in the current version of the RRATalog), and provides a sample input files for theupdate_rrats.shscript.Before/after plots attached.
